All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/pa/somerset/ _______________________________________________ PYLE Martin Luther Pyle, 69, of Rockwood RD 2, died June 3, in Somerset Community Hospital. Born Dec. 2, 1904 in Middlecreek Township, a son of the late Homer D. and Minnie Snyder Pyle. Survived by his wife, Elizabeth (Pyle) Pyle of Rockwood Rd 2; two sons, Richard Gale Pyle of S. Carolina and George, at home; one stepson, Blaine Pyle of Garrett; four daughters: Mrs. Terry Colflesh of Confluence RD 3; Mrs. Anna Vetters of Virginia; Miss Bonnie and Miss Betty Jean, both at home; five grandchildren and one great-grandchild. Friends will be received in the William J. Wood Funeral Home, Rockwood from 2 to 4 and 7 to 9 p.m. today where services will be conducted Wednesday at 2 p.m. with the Rev. Gene Abel officiating. Interment in Union Cemetery of New Centerville. Somerset Bulletin, June 4, 1974 [P1189]
